Member of Technical Staff, Applications Omnifold trains custom AI models that help planners forecast the future. At the application layer, our users interact with those models - creating forecasts, understanding why predictions shifted, and feeding context back into the system.

What makes this job interesting:

  • You will build interfaces that are both data-dense and elegant

  • You will design thoughtful human-LLM interaction patterns for real-world problems

  • You will constantly be making real product and architecture decisions.

What we're looking for:

  • 5+ years full-stack experience, weighted toward frontend

  • Must have a strong Computer Science background (CS Degree, or developed a product with core computer science fundamentals e.g. compilers, search)

  • Experience with data-dense interfaces: dashboards, analytics products, planning tools

  • TypeScript, React 18+, Tailwind, Python

  • Experience with end-to-end feature development (requirements -> concept -> mocks -> technical design -> implementation -> documentation)

  • The ability to amplify your good taste + judgement using modern AI tools

Useful but not required:

  • Experience building:

  • features involving LLM or ML interactions

  • Enterprise SaaS

  • Application security and other systems design experience

Location: San Francisco (in-person, 5 days per week)

Omnifold’s Mission

Every bad forecast has a physical consequence. Unnecessary goods are manufactured, shipped, and stored. Emergency air freight is needed for misallocated products. Poor production planning means workers show up with nothing to do, or work frantic overtime. Inefficiency is everywhere.

Our mission is to eliminate waste and accelerate growth for every company with physical products.
